Understanding Polydimethylsiloxane Fluid
Polydimethylsiloxane fluid is a type of silicone oil that exhibits remarkable properties, making it suitable for a wide range of applications. It is characterized by its low viscosity, high thermal stability, and excellent hydrophobicity. In the cosmetic industry, PDMS is often used in skincare products to impart a smooth, silky feel and to enhance the formulation's stability. In the food sector, it serves as a lubricant in manufacturing processes, ensuring that machinery operates smoothly without contamination. Industrial manufacturing also benefits from PDMS, utilizing it as a release agent, anti-foaming agent, and even in electrical insulation. The quality of polydimethylsiloxane fluid can vary significantly among suppliers; thus, sourcing high-quality PDMS is essential to achieving optimal performance in its respective applications.
Criteria for Selecting Suppliers
When searching for suppliers of polydimethylsiloxane fluid, it's crucial to consider several key criteria. First and foremost, quality control measures should be assessed; suppliers must adhere to strict quality standards to ensure the PDMS they provide is safe and effective. Certifications from reputable organizations can serve as a benchmark for evaluating a supplier's credibility. Additionally, understanding a supplier's production capabilities is vital. This includes their ability to meet your specific volume needs and delivery timelines. Excellent customer service is equally important; responsive and helpful suppliers can make the sourcing process smoother and more efficient. Lastly, consider supplier reputation through reviews or testimonials from other businesses to gauge reliability and product quality.
